As the Sr. Building Performance Engineer you will lead Armstrong's building-energy modeling program to quantify and communicate the performance impact of our energy-efficient products and accelerate their adoption in U.S. commercial buildings. You'll work primarily in IESVE (ModelIT, Apache/ApacheHVAC, VistaPro; VE Navigators for ASHRAE 90.1/LEED/Title 24) to consult on projects and deliver code-compliance, LEED, and owner-option analyses comparing designs using Armstrong solutions to baseline cases. Core focus areas include assessing Templok PCM ceiling tiles (and future products) for new construction and renovations; quantifying cost/benefit; and recommending design and operational strategies using the Templok model in IESVE 2025. You will also run calibrated simulations to support M&V, translate findings into reports and technical marketing content, and educate the market via webinars and conference sessions. The role blends technical sales, building-energy modeling expertise, and cross-functional collaboration to shape Armstrong's energy-solutions portfolio and accelerate market adoption with clear, defensible modeling evidence.

What does a Sr. Building Performance Engineer do?
Technical Sales and Modeling Support
* Partners with A/E firms and ESCOs from concept modeling through high-fidelity IESVE simulations to analyze design options and quantify financial cases to incorporate Armstrong products in building energy designs.
* Quantifies annual energy/cost impacts, peak-load reduction, sizing changes, and first-cost trade-offs for Templok and new solutions.
* Performs load calculations; support system selection and sizing (coils, fans, pumps) and psychrometrics; draft BAS sequences to leverage Templok within ASHRAE 55 comfort guidelines.
* Supports code-compliance modeling and submittals (ASHRAE 90.1 PRM/Appendix G, IECC, Title 24) and LEED EA documentation leveraging Armstrong products on customer projects.
* Builds early-phase screening tools and VE scripts/post-processing to accelerate building performance evaluations and highlight the contributions of Armstrong solutions.
* Leads IESVE studies across building types and climates; define scenarios and present results and recommendations to technical and executive audiences.
Technical Marketing & M&V
* Performs calibrated simulations (ASHRAE Guideline 14/IPMVP) for real projects; write concise M&V reports and case studies; present results to technical and non-technical audiences.
* Translates results into clear value propositions/metrics for the customer: peak reduction, hours-of-exceedance, PMV/PPD, economics (payback, LCCA), etc.
* Contributes to grid-interactive, load-shifting, and demand/cost analyses where applicable.
Product & Tooling Development
* Leverages IESVE simulations and project experience to inform product roadmap.
* Establishes QA/QC checklists, acceptance criteria, and reference VE files to ensure reproducibility of modeling results.
* Develops a library of IESVE simulation results and parametric runs as quick-lookup reference cases to inform product performance estimates across building/climate scenarios.
* Develops rough-order performance tools calibrated to VE results and first-principles heat-transfer methods for early-phase estimation and sales enablement.
Industry Expertise
* Maintains current knowledge of ASHRAE 55/62.1/90.1, Standard 140, IECC, Title 24, LEED and regional programs.
* Mentors junior modelers; perform formal peer reviews; deliver internal trainings on VE workflows, QA/QC, and documentation standards.

How much does an automation engineer earn in Lancaster, PA?
The average automation engineer in Lancaster, PA earns between $65,000 and $110,000 annually. This compares to the national average automation engineer range of $70,000 to $121,000.
Average automation engineer salary in Lancaster, PA
$85,000
